Index of /bucket/80/24/e8/


../
bucket-8024e8249b0e0f46741b184ff7c8af9422705a96..> 04-Jan-2022 19:21               22574
bucket-8024e8d84e63a84d03af25be98d1b2097ca6c912..> 26-May-2024 09:40              101866